The healing water!

First days in school are always difficult, especially if you are a baby!

Slide3I suggest a small tip on how to help babies relax when they are stressed.

Slide5Use water. Just water. Or, water with small rocks, sand, plastic balls, toy ducks and anything else you can imagine.

Slide4When babies play with water, they relax and release all their stress.

Babies paint with colored ice cubes

Babies (1-2 y.o.) discover the  world through their senses.

IMGP1792

In our school, an activity they love doing is producing colored ice cubes.

IMGP1794

Then, kids use those ice cubes to paint, while melting.
